Is Investing In Certified Gold Coins Safe?


Investing in certified gold coins is not only safe it is a very wise investment strategy. Whether you are investing for your retirement or investing in order to make money, certified gold coins are a good choice for your portfolio. Most people hear the word investing and automatically think of stocks or bonds.

Experienced investors know that while stocks and bonds can make money for them and some are good choices for an investment portfolio, they can also offer some very large risks. Any time the economy changes the chance is there for the stock market to change as well, often overnight. This can result in huge losses for those who have chosen to invest in stocks and bonds. Certified gold coins seldom lose as much value based on a change in the economy.

Certified gold coins are a relatively stable investment. When the economy is facing troubled times, gold is often the only substance that not only retains its value but often increases in value. Certified gold coins do not depend on the ability of a company to continue to make a profit in rough economic times. They do not depend on new products or services to increase their value. Certified gold coins have an intrinsic value all of their own.

You could consider certified gold coins the same way that you would a money market savings account. While you may not make a fortune from this investment you will very likely not lose money with it either. Gold coins are normally valued by the amount of gold contained in the coin itself. While this can make them a costly investment it also makes them a secure investment.

Many people think that investing in gold coins is too expensive for them to consider. However, they do not realize that there are many different sizes of certified gold coins to choose from on the market. It is true that purchasing a 1 ounce gold coin may be out of some people's price range, but there are other gold coins that are as low as 1/10 to ounce that makes them affordable while still being a sound investment.

The availability of certified gold coins in many different sizes and price ranges makes it possible for anyone interested in investing in gold coins to find coins that they can afford. Whether you are a large investor or just getting started you can find certified gold coins to add to your investment portfolio.
